Hip hop purists and old school fans have one more reason to celebrate today. After making history in hip hop’s early years, Roxanne Shante` and MC Shan are set to reform the legendary Juice Crew.

Shante` and Shan are hoping to bring the name and legacy back with a fresh crop of talented emcees that aren’t afraid to stray from today’s music norms.

“We can make it any ole’ crew,”MC Shan says. “But we want to make it something people know so it can carry on the legacy of the original crew.” Shan also emphasizes, “The new Juice Crew will be something different; not the ‘I slang drugs, I got jewelry’ rhymes; it’ll be more talented artists.”

The original crew consisted of Big Daddy Kane, Biz Markie, Craig G., Kool G. Rap, Master Ace, Marley Marl, Shan and Shante`. The group got a big push from NYC DJ Mr. Magic in the mid 80’s.

The crew is perhaps best remembered for the song The Bridge which began one of hip hop’s most well known battles with KRS-ONE’s Boogie Down Productions.
